It started life as an outbuilding, with old shutters nailed down for a floor. Then, over its 300 years, it grew into a breezy summer cottage. Finally, thanks to a smart remodel, it's now a comfortable family home
The eating area, a long-ago shed-roofed addition, is located at the far end of what is now the family room. The Gavants chose to retain the cozy 7-foot ceiling height and had 6-foot-tall insulated glass French doors made to replace four windows. They lead to the newly expanded deck.
The existing half-round window above the dining alcove lets even more light into the vaulted-ceilinged family room.
